Nicks says Crows won’t tag Serong, but they have ‘Plan B’
By Mitchell Woodcock
Adelaide coach Matthew Nicks has flagged that they won’t start with a tag on Fremantle superstar Caleb Serong, but says they have a “Plan B” ready to go should he get off the leash.
The Dockers vice-captain was restricted to 16 disposals in round two under heavy attention from Melbourne’s Koltyn Tholstrup, as rival teams continue to attempt to lock down the three-time All-Australian.
Serong responded with a near best-on-ground performance in the win against Richmond on Saturday, gathering 32 disposals, nine clearances, eight inside 50s, six tackles and two goals.
